Cotarelo v. Village of Sleepy Hollow Police Dep't, 04-4627

Summary judgment for defendants and dismissal of First Amendment retaliation and political affiliation claims is affirmed where defendants demonstrated as a matter of law that the same adverse employment action would have been taken even in the absence of plaintiff's protected speech and political affiliation.
